Those land management activities which may harm the environment are addressed by the Council's four regional plans. Regional Fresh Water Plan, Regional Air Quality Plan, Regional Coastal Plan and Regional Soil Plan. As well as non-regulatory methods they contain rules that may require resource consents for some activities.
Regional Soil plan
The issues of soil loss and soil health are addressed largely by non-regulatory methods, although there are limited permissive rules controlling vegetation disturbance over five hectares on land over 28 degrees.
